INTERCOM VOLUME AND SQUELCH
The
PILOT/PASS
Knob controls volume or manual squelch adjustment for the pilot and copilot/passenger.
The small knob controls the pilot volume and squelch. The large knob controls the copilot/passenger volume
and squelch. The VOL and SQ annunciations at the bottom of the unit indicate which function the knob is
controlling. Pressing the
PILOT/PASS
Knob switches between volume and squelch control as indicated by
the VOL or SQ annunciation being illuminated.
The
MAN SQ
Key allows either automatic or manual control of the squelch setting.
When the MAN SQ Annunciator is extinguished (Automatic Squelch is on), the
PILOT/PASS
Knob
controls only the volume (pressing the
PILOT/PASS
Knob has no effect on the VOL/SQ selection).
When the MAN SQ Annunciator is illuminated (Manual Squelch), the
PILOT/PASS
Knob controls
either volume or squelch (selected by pressing the PILOT/PASS Knob and indicated by the VOL or SQ
annunciation).
